How is your life different than it would have been if you never received the transfer?
Unlike before give directly came to our village I had not proper house but now I am building a strong house that will be my home for more years to come
In your opinion, what does GiveDirectly do well, and what does it not do well?
Give directly did well in guiding us on not using the money on things that could harm human life or the environment
What did you spend your most recent transfer(s) on?
I was living in a mud, grass thatched house which some times scares me during rains in fear of the house falling down or the roof being blown away by winds so after I received the money from give directly I have started building a strong house with burnt bricks and cement and I will use ironsheet on the roof

Describe the moment when you received your money. How did you feel?
When i received the transfer I was the happiest person ever, for receiving money from GD was like a blessing that I wish to reach many more
Describe the biggest difference in your daily life since you started receiving payments from GiveDirectly.
Once i received money from GD my life has changed a lot, things are not the same, I had nothing, but now I managed to buy iron sheet, a bed and mattress, blankets, bags of maize and fertilizer.
What did you spend your most recent transfer(s) on?
I spent my transfer on buying thing I needed the most like; iron sheets, a bed and mattress, blankets, bags of maize and fertilizer

What does receiving this money mean to you?
It means alot to me. I will use the money to build a house and start a business of selling fish or tomatoes.
What is the happiest part of your day?
Am happiest whenever my basic needs are met.
What is the biggest hardship you've faced in your life?
The biggest hardship I face is a lack of a proper house to live in and food to eat 3 times a day.
